Output 2e50da3e13a352f1a085476539270f4427d18a1916996ed10f54e42e089b5835:25

value
668669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eccbf1940a1cad40162d14505fc32e33051f2d1 OP_EQUAL
address
333GfGGqUAg7QE5xHAKmsJS9sGgLG7JCmW
transaction
2e50da3e13a352f1a085476539270f4427d18a1916996ed10f54e42e089b5835
spent
true